The Opposition is accusing the Government of potential abuse of power and infringement on citizens’ constitutional rights following the recent declaration of a state of emergency. This accusation was led by Opposition Leader Pennelope Beckles during a news conference. The state of emergency was declared following a National Security Council meeting, spearheaded by Prime Minister Kamla Persad-Bissessar. The Prime Minister declared the state of emergency in response to a rise in gang-related crime and credible intelligence about planned attacks on the protective services. Beckles expressed concerns about the regulations in the state of emergency notice and urged citizens to scrutinize them.
